After the grade crossing, to the left was Fruits' Basic Station and, also to your left at 302 W Vandalia it was Bothman's Garage and Ford deealership its gone; now a bank stands there. To your right, on the NE edge of W Vandalia and St. Louis (316 St. Louis) was Adams Criterion solution terminal (it is highlighted in pink in the map below), currently a water fountain depends on a nice plaza.Louis proceeds westwards. On the NW corner of N Benton and St. Louis was the Colonial Hotel.

Click on picture for complete dimension map Route 66 becomes St. Louis, proceed west for 3 blocks, and at West St. Course 66 transforms sharply to the right was another service terminal: On the SE corner at 198 West St. Originally a Madison Oil Co.
It was named the West End Service Station in 1936 when the brand-new yellow-brick building was built. Thomas Bar and Ralph Ellsworth operated it for some time before relocating west along Route 66 (on the corner of W Schwarz, where the Circle K is).

Legate's Motel and Hilltop Home dining establishment c. 1950, US 66, Edwardsville, Il. Credit scores 1968 airborne image of Wolf and Legate motels. Click thumbnail to Expand Wolf's motel was across the road from Legate's and was open during the mid 1960s and early 1970s. Throughout the 1950s it had actually run as the Gerber's motel and had a filling station.

The Madison Area seat, Edwardsville is in the Metro East area and part of Greater St. Louis. The city is home to Southern Illinois University Edwardsville (SIUE), with an expansive university west of downtown, and swelling Edwardsville's populace during the term. The center of Edwardsville is a pleasure, with a dynamic summer season market, great deals of independent companies and style dating back a century or even more.

1820 Colonel Benjamin Stephenson Home The oldest brick residence in Edwardsville is owned by the city and open to the public as a museum. In the Federal style, with five bays and an ell included in 1845, the Benjamin Stephenson home is valued for its building beauty yet likewise its connection to Illinois history.
